Naugatuck Candidate Profile: Robert Neth For Burgess
Robert Neth shares with Patch why he should be re-elected to the Board of Mayor and Burgess as a Republican.

NAUGATUCK, CT β Naugatuck's election season is heating and there are plenty of contested races with candidates eager to get their name on the ballot for the city's municipal election. One of those contested races is the race for the Board of Mayor and Burgesses.
Naugatuck Patch asked candidates in the contested races to answer questions about their campaigns and will be publishing candidate profiles as election day draws near.
Robert Neth, 61, is running for the Board of Mayor and Burgesses and is running as a Republican.

The single most pressing issue facing our town/district is _______, and this is what I intend to do about it. *
Taxes is always the main issue, the goal is to build the grand list to reduce the tax burden. Right now we have a lot of irons in the fire that are extremely important to build the grand list
What are the critical differences between you and the other candidates seeking this post? *
Not sure there are critical issues between myself and other candidates, my resume speaks for itself in the amount of work I have done over the last 30 years. 29 different sub-committees that have made differences in the Borough.
List other issues that define your campaign platform:
Take a common sense approach to government, I'm fair, honest, consistent and independent thinker on all issues
What accomplishments in your past would you cite as evidence you can handle this job?
Chairman of the Naugatuck Standing Building committee, Chairman of the Naugatuck HS, $81 million renovation project (under budget and on time), Chairman of the 5 year capital committee (all major projects Town and Board of Education), Member of the Long Term Building committee, Chairman renewable energy committee(solar and LED light projects)
